I am unable to switch environment from Remix London to Injected Provider-Metamask for testing out my smartcontract, currently my metamask is on Rinkeby Test network.
4 Answers
I would suggest the following:
Switch to a different browser with MetaMask and reconnect
OR
Ensure MetaMask is unlocked, refresh RemixIDE, and reconnect
-
1Thank you, I switched the browser and try to reconnect , boom it worked. Sep 12, 2022 at 7:21
-
1
I encountered the same problem, however, refreshing the page after unlocking metamask solved the problem for me.
Hey is it showing any error? Or maybe you can try out another network as well. Also, share the screenshot for the same.
-
My contract compiled successfully and I also checked with other networks too, but remix not switching to Injected Provider. Sep 11, 2022 at 14:13
-
What error is it showing. There is nothing to do with the compilation and all. Sep 12, 2022 at 5:59
Try these ways:
- Switch to a different browser with MetaMask and reconnect.
- Ensure MetaMask is unlocked, refresh RemixIDE, and reconnect.
- last,try removing other wallets from extensions(like safePal wallet, math Wallet, trustWallet, etc) which might be conflicting with the Metamask.